Find the length and width of a rectangle whose perimeter is 22ft and area of 30sq ft

Mathematics
1 answer:
Debora [2.8K]3 years ago
8 0
L=5
W=6
2L+2W=22
L x W =30

A tablet computer costs 189.69. it is marked up 30%. What is the final price of the tablet computer after its marked up.
saveliy_v [14]
The initial cost is 189.69. It is marked up 30%.

By simple calculations, 

Final cost of the tablet computer = Initial price + 30% of marked price

= 189.69 + (30/100 x 189.69)

This gives us the net value of 245.7. Hence the price of the computer after it's been marked up will be 245.7
